Storrs
UConn's picturesque main campus, home to 19,000 undergraduates, makes for an energizing, inspiring and inclusive environment.
UConn Waterbury
Experience the close-knit community spirit of a modern campus set against a vibrant downtown.
UConn Hartford
Study in Connecticut's center of government — and the "Insurance Capital of the World."
UConn Stamford
Live and learn in a financial hub that's conveniently close to New York City.

Scholarships*
Merit scholarships of up to $15,000 per year. First year students will be automatically considered for this renewable award.
*If you're planning to start in January 2021, please note that all Spring 2021 semester courses will be taught remotely due to the COVID-19 pandemic. Check out our dedicated website for the latest information.
*Please note, tuition after the maximum scholarship is $22,698 per academic year
(prices are valid for 2021–22).
